What is Metabolic Flexibility?

Think of your metabolism as a hybrid car. A normal car can only run on gas (sugar). A hybrid car can switch to electricity (fat) whenever it needs to. Most people have "broken" this switch by eating too many processed carbs and snacking constantly. Metabolic flexibility is the process of fixing that switch.

How to Build a Flexible Metabolism: The 3-Step Protocol

Step 1: The "Fat-First" Morning

Stop spiking your insulin the moment you wake up. By having a high-protein, high-fat breakfast (or skipping it entirely), you force your body to keep burning fat from the previous night. This "extends" your fat-burning window into the late afternoon.

Step 2: Zone 2 Fasted Movement

A simple 20-minute walk before your first meal of the day is a metabolic cheat code. Low-intensity movement in a fasted state signals your mitochondria to prioritize fat oxidation over glucose storage.

Step 3: Carbohydrate Cycling

We don't hate carbs at KJ Healthy Living. We just time them. Save your carbohydrates for the evenings or after a heavy workout. This ensures the sugar goes to your muscles for recovery, rather than being stored as fat by your liver.
